BPTM
Heat-shrinkable busbar insulation tubing
Voltage class 25 kV
Application Ø 6.5 – 220 mm

Product description
BPTM is a medium wall, heat-shrink-
able tubing which provides insulation
enhancement and protection against
flashover and accidentally induced
discharge. Particularly useful in con-
fined spaces BPTM tubing can be
used on both circular and rectangular
copper or aluminium busbars.
On application of heat the tubing
shrinks snugly over the busbar profile
ensuring that the required minimum
wall thickness is obtained. BPTM
tubing can be installed easily during
large scale production using an oven
or in the field using a gas torch or hot
air. BPTM tubing is manufactured
from a non-halogen based polymer
which has excellent performance in
high voltage environments and greatly
reduces the noxious and corrosive
effects in fire situations.

Applications
The use of BPTM tubing allows equip-
ment designers the freedom to reduce
air spacing between busbars, such
as in the manufacture of switchgear
cabinets where space is at a premium.
BPTM provides flashover protection
up to 25 kV.

Clearance reduction
The table below indicates the clear-
ance reductions which are possible
using BPTM tubing. These are derived
from BIL, AC withstand, DC withstand
and discharge extinction tests. These
clearances should not be adopted

BPTM Heat-shrinkable busbar insulation tubing


Key product specifications Test method Requirement
Thermal endurance IEC 216 105°C min.
Accelerated ageing ISO 188, ASTM D2671 168 hrs @ 120°C
- Tensile strength 10 MPa min.
- Ultimate elongation 300% min.
Comparative tracking index IEC 112, VDE 0303/1 KA 3c
Dielectric strength ASTM D149, IEC 243 180 kV/cm min. @ 2 mm
150 kV/cm min. @ 2.5 mm
120 kV/cm min. @ 3 mm
Low temperature flexibility ASTM D2671 Procedure C No cracking after 4 hrs @ -40°C
Smoke index NES 711 Less than 120
Acid gas generation Raychem PPS 3010 4.23 Less than 1% by weight
Note: For further product specification information see Raychem PPS 3010/04.
